485,024 (four hundred eighty-five thousand twenty-four) is an even 6-digit number. It is a composite number with 24 divisors, and factors as 2⁵ × 23 × 659. Its proper divisors sum to 512,896, more than the number itself, making it an abundant number. Written other ways, in hexadecimal, 0x766A0.
